Lecture halls bring together a large quantity of people in a contained place for quite a bit of time. Most people keep to themselves, text and occasionally scribble down notes. Unfortunately, other people aren’t as low-key. These seven types of people are hard to miss.

1. The Eater

Whether it be a bag of chips or a full-on rotisserie chicken, this person is distracting as hell. The hall is filled with the fumes of food, which makes your stomach begin to make embarrassing hungry noises. You hate this person, but you also want to be them. The existential crisis that this brings forward is too unbearable.

2. The Best Friends

These two are hard to miss. They maintain a constant stream of whispering and giggling throughout the class. You assume they’ll stop once the professor eyes them, but somehow they keep on prattling. You admire their perseverance and passion for living, however misplaced it may be.

3. The Music Lover

Music is great, but not necessarily when you are forced to listen to it. This person just doesn’t understand the concept of low volume. Maybe, just maybe this wouldn’t be so annoying if it didn’t always end up being the people with poor music taste. This person needs to consider that not everyone wants to have screamo buzzing in their ears at eight in the morning.

4. The Giggler

You can’t even be mad at this person. They’re either watching videos of dogs on Facebook or Vines and just can’t keep it together. Their entertainment with it is kind of endearing with a pinch of annoying.

5. The Online Shopper

Usually a girl, this person spends the whole class adding things to her basket on multiple sites. Will she end up purchasing? Probably not, but virtual window shopping sure is a way to make time fly. Almost like a yawn, she makes you want to join her in feeding that shopping addiction.

6. The Sleeper

This person is just amusing. They give you great content for your Snapchat story and an excuse to caption a picture with “same.” They may be silent, snoring or even making soft little moaning noises. Overall, an embarrassing type to be, but a fun one to witness.

7. The Listener

This type may be the most annoying of all. They sit, pay attention to the professor, take thorough notes and genuinely look interested. They are not forcing themselves on any of your senses, but somehow they make you feel the worst. They induce an overwhelming sense of guilt that they are doing exactly what you should be doing. We all endeavor to be this person.

At the end of the day, we have to admit to being each type at least once. We never seem to find things annoying when we are the ones doing them, but nevertheless they still are. Never have shame in your lecture game, but maybe stop bothering the people around you.
